Description
A Request for Proposal (RFP) will be solicited for the following items: Tent Soldier Crew, Green/Tan, NSN: 8340-01-359-0084 and Tent Soldier Crew, Green/White, NSN: 8340-01-359-1481. This will be an Indefinite Delivery Type Contract (IDTC) with the following minimum and maximum quantities of any color combination for the base year and four one-year term option years: Minimum: 140 each / Maximum: 1500 each.     This solicitation will be issued as a Total Small Business Set-Aside. Delivery Orders will be placed with any combination of color for two destinations. The destinations for subject items are: Defense Distribution Depot, Barstow, CA and Defense Distribution Depot, New Cumberland, PA, with deliveries commencing 240 days after date of award. See numbered notes 1, 9 & 26. Best Value Source Selection procedures will be utilized in this solicitation and offerors will be required to submit a technical proposal with the following evaluations factors: Past Performance and DLA Mentoring Business Agreement. Submittal of First Article is required one hundred and twenty (120) days after date of award. DFARS clause 252.211-7006 ?Radio Frequency Identification? applies to this solicitation. The Defense Appropriations and Authorization Acts and other statutes (including what is commonly referred to as ?The Berry Amendment?) impose restrictions on the DoD?s acquisition of foreign products and services. Generally, Clothing and Textile items (as defined in DFARS 252.225-7014), including the materials and components thereof (other than sensors, electronics, or other items added to, and not normally associated with clothing), must be grown, reprocessed, reused, melted or produced in the United States, its possessions or Puerto Rico, unless one of the DFARS 225.7002-2 exceptions applies.
